What to Expect in Episode 4 of Percy Jackson

Episode 4 of Percy Jackson and the Olympians will take viewers on an exciting journey centered around the iconic St. Louis Arch. Drawing inspiration from Rick Riordan’s bestselling novel, “The Lightning Thief,” this episode features a thrilling sequence that was not included in the previous film adaptations.

The plot revolves around Percy’s encounter with the Chimera, a fearsome mythical beast, at the top of the St. Louis Arch. In a gripping battle, Percy puts his demigod skills to the test, but ultimately finds himself in a perilous situation. To escape the imminent danger, he decides to take a daring plunge from the arch into the water below. As a son of Poseidon, the god of the sea, Percy’s survival is ensured.

See also  Lydia's Fate in The Walking Dead Revealed

This adaptation of the St. Louis Arch sequence introduces a thrilling and visually captivating scene that fans of the series have been eagerly awaiting. With exquisite attention to detail, the TV series brings this pivotal moment from the book to life, providing an immersive experience for viewers.

In addition to the St. Louis Arch sequence, Episode 4 of Percy Jackson and the Olympians will also feature a touching domestic scene between Percy and Annabeth. Set on an Amtrak train, this heartfelt moment adds depth to the characters and their relationship, showcasing the emotional nuances of their journey.

FAQ

When will the fourth episode of Percy Jackson and the Olympians be released?

The fourth episode of Percy Jackson and the Olympians TV series is set to be released on Tuesday, January 2, 2024, at 9:00 p.m. ET.

What is the title of episode 4 and what will it focus on?

Episode 4 is titled “I Plunge to My Death” and will focus on the events surrounding the St. Louis Arch, where Percy battles the Chimera.

Will the St. Louis Arch scene be an adaptation from the books?

Yes, this scene marks the first adaptation of the St. Louis Arch segment from Rick Riordan’s novel, “The Lightning Thief.”

Will there be any additional scenes in episode 4?

Yes, there will be a domestic scene between Percy and Annabeth on an Amtrak train.
